NLS_LANG cannot be changed by ALTER SESSION, NLS_LANGUAGE and NLS_TERRITORY can. However NLS_LANGUAGE and /or NLS_TERRITORY cannot be set as "standalone" parameters in the environment or registry on the client.
Evidently the "right" solution is, before logging into Oracle at all, setting the following environment variable:
export NLS_LANG=AMERICAN_AMERICA.UTF8
